Biography

Civil trial practice is an area that particularly holds Mr. Banks’ interest. “Although the vast majority of cases are settled, I treat every case as if it will be tried,” he said. “Every strategy I employ is geared toward the possibility that the case will ultimately end up in front of a jury. There are many litigators, but few can actually successfully take a case to trial.”

Mr. Banks thrives on achieving a fair and honest outcome for his clients. “Over the years, I have learned that my clients are not trying to escape obligation, but simply want to pay what is fair,” he said. “If I tell a client a case should go to trial, then I will push for a trial and a jury verdict. When cases should be settled, I will so inform the client. I have no need to run up billable hours. My goal is to achieve the best possible outcome for clients, without compromising my integrity.”
